Understanding Water Well Drill Bit Pricing

When it comes to water well drilling, the choice of drill bit is crucial for efficiency and effectiveness. The wholesale price of water well drill bits can vary significantly based on several factors including material, size, and technology used in manufacturing. Generally, high-quality bits made from durable materials like tungsten carbide tend to be more expensive but offer better performance and longevity.

In the wholesale market, buyers often look for bulk purchasing options to reduce costs. Suppliers typically offer discounts for larger orders, making it essential for companies engaged in water well drilling to consider their purchasing strategy. Understanding the pricing structure can help businesses optimize their expenses while ensuring they have access to reliable equipment.

Factors Influencing Wholesale Prices

Several factors influence the wholesale prices of water well drill bits. First, the type of drilling application plays a significant role. For instance, drill bits designed for soft soil may be less expensive than those engineered for rock formations. Additionally, specialized bits that incorporate advanced technology such as PDC (Polycrystalline Diamond Compact) can command higher prices due to their enhanced capabilities.

Another important factor is the manufacturer’s reputation and production volume. Established brands with a track record of quality may charge more for their products, reflecting their investment in research and development. Conversely, newer or lesser-known manufacturers might offer competitive pricing to penetrate the market, which could be an attractive option for buyers looking to save on costs.

Tips for Purchasing Water Well Drill Bits Wholesale

To secure the best deals on water well drill bits, buyers should conduct thorough market research. This includes comparing prices across different suppliers and understanding the specifications of the bits being offered. Reaching out to multiple vendors can provide insights into current market trends and price fluctuations, allowing buyers to make informed decisions.

Additionally, establishing a long-term relationship with a reliable supplier can lead to better pricing and priority access to new products. Regular communication and negotiations about bulk orders can result in advantageous terms, further reducing overall costs. Always consider the total cost of ownership, including maintenance and replacement, when evaluating drill bit prices.
